Named after the mythical figure who dared to soar too close to the sun & the furthest star seen from the planet earth, Icarus Talent Agency embodies the spirit of ambition, innovation, and fearlessness. We believe in pushing boundaries, defying limitations, and crafting unforgettable experiences that captivate audiences worldwide.

The logo embodies a telescope capturing the radiant light of the stars, while the array of colors symbolizes the diverse spectrum of emotions that the talents represented by Icarus impart to the world.

The Agency specialize in uncovering hidden gems and guiding them to stardom through a dynamic array of events and initiatives.

Icarus Brand Identity

Icarus Brand Identity
